The Sabuga Fountain in the town of Sintra. Osberno (a 12th-century crusader) claimed that its waters eased coughs, while Aquilégio (1726) attributed qualities to it in treating "bilious diarrhea." Presently, users ascribe digestive qualities to it.
Located in the center of Sintra village and boasting a thousand years of history, the Sintra National Palace is Portugal's oldest.
Designed by the esteemed architect José Luiz Monteiro and constructed in the final decades of the 19th century, surrounded by an extensive and majestic Botanical Park designed by the renowned landscaper François Nogré, the building stands as a unique example of Portuguese Romantic architecture.

The Moorish Castle in Sintra stands atop a rocky massif, isolated on one of the peaks of the Sintra mountain range in Estremadura. From the top of its walls, there's a privileged view of its entire rural surroundings stretching all the way to the Atlantic Ocean.

In close proximity to the historic center, Quinta Regaleira stands as one of Sintra's most mysterious sites. Constructed at the onset of the 20th century, the Quinta da Regaleira Palace was commissioned by the millionaire António Augusto Carvalho Monteiro (1848-1920).
Writers' retreat, Monserrate attracted numerous foreign travelers, particularly the English, who extolled its beauty in travel accounts and engravings. When Francis Cook, a wealthy English industrialist from the 19th century and a great art collector, visited the site, he was captivated. From that passion emerged a masterpiece of Romanticism: the Monserrate Park and Palace.
Considered one of the 49 pre-finalists in the 7 Wonders of Portugal, in the Villages category, Penedo is still regarded as one of the most traditional villages in Sintra, possibly the most traditional of all.
Cabo da Roca is the westernmost point of continental Europe, situated at the edge of the Sintra Mountains, and one of Portugal's most emblematic locations. Dating back to 1722, it consists of a 22-meter-high tower, and its light has a luminous range of about 26 nautical miles, roughly 48 kilometers. Shrouded in mist or bathed in splendid sunlight, this inspiring place has been a member of the "Sri Chinmoy Peace Blossoms" program dedicated to peace since 1989
A true picture-postcard scene, Azenhas do Mar surprises with its geographical location, where houses cascade down the cliffside to the sea, bathed in an idealized, whitewashed light. It's one of the most beloved beaches for swimmers, featuring an ocean pool that delights visitors. The sandy area doesn't exceed 30 meters, yet during high tides, it can entirely disappear. Once an old fishing village, it has, in recent decades, transformed into a tranquil summer spot and a source of inspiration for many painters like Júlio Pomar, Emílio da Paula Campos, or Milly Possoz.
